8 Healthy Foods For Your Weight Loss Journey

Leafy greens like spinach, kale, and Swiss chard are low in calories and high in fiber, which helps keep you full and satisfied. They're also packed with essential vitamins and minerals.

1. Leafy Greens

Incorporate lean protein sources such as chicken breast, turkey, fish, tofu, and beans into your diet. Protein helps maintain muscle mass and keeps you feeling full, reducing overall calorie consumption.

2. Lean Proteins

Opt for whole grains like brown rice, quinoa, and whole wheat bread over refined grains. Whole grains are rich in fiber, which can help control blood sugar and keep you feeling full longer.

3. Whole Grains

Berries like strawberries, blueberries, and raspberries are low in calories and high in antioxidants and fiber. They add natural sweetness to your diet and can be a satisfying snack or addition to your breakfast.

4. Berries

While they are calorie-dense, nuts and seeds like almonds, walnuts, and chia seeds can be a part of a healthy diet when consumed in moderation. They provide healthy fats, protein, and fiber, which can help control hunger.

5. Nuts and Seeds

Greek yogurt is high in protein and lower in sugar than many other yogurt options. It's a great source of calcium and can be a filling and nutritious snack or breakfast.

6. Greek Yogurt

A variety of fruits and vegetables should be a cornerstone of your diet. They are low in calories and high in fiber, vitamins, and minerals. The fiber in fruits and vegetables helps keep you full and satisfied.

7. Fruits and Vegetables

Fatty fish like salmon are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which have numerous health benefits, including weight management. They can help reduce inflammation and improve insulin sensitivity.

8. Salmon
